What does the inequality k < 3 represent on a number line?
Back
It represents all numbers to the left of 3, not including 3 itself.

What is the definition of an inequality?
Back
An inequality is a mathematical statement that compares two expressions and shows that one is less than, greater than, less than or equal to, or greater than or equal to the other.
